Donald Tusk: EU to discuss sanctions against Russia in March

In March the European Union will discuss new steps on sanctions against Russia at the Summit of the member States of the community.

Donald Tusk, the President of the European Council, told about it in the European Parliament on Tuesday, January 13, TASS informs.

"In December we agreed that the best thing for then was to 'stay the course'. We will decide the next steps in March", he said.

Donald Tusk also said that the EU would support Ukraine financially.

In late February, early March 2014, unmarked troops, brought in from Russia and Crimean Black Sea navy bases, seized the Crimean peninsula.

March 16, 2014 there was held a so-called referendum on the status of the peninsula in the Crimea and Sevastopol, after which Russia administered Crimea as its part. Neither Ukraine nor the European Union, nor the United States did not recognize the vote and believe Crimea has been annexed.

After that, the United States and the European Union have introduced a number of economic sanctions against Russia. The West insists that Crimea is a part of Ukraine.
